js计算器_
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
JavaScript计算器是一种常见的网页交互元素,它使用JavaScript编程语言来实现基本的算术运算。这个项目包含HTML、CSS和JS三个主要部分,分别负责计算器的结构、样式和功能逻辑。 我们从HTML文件开始。HTML(HyperText Markup Language)是构建网页内容的基础,它定义了计算器的布局和按钮。一个简单的计算器界面可能包括数字按钮(0-9)、运算符按钮(如+、-、×、÷)、等号按钮(=)以及清除按钮(C)。HTML文件会使用`<input>`标签创建一个显示计算结果的文本框,`<button>`标签用于创建各个按钮,通过设置按钮的`onclick`属性来绑定JavaScript函数,实现点击按钮时的响应。 接下来,CSS(Cascading Style Sheets)文件用于美化计算器的外观。它可以设置按钮的大小、颜色、边框、间距等样式属性,使计算器看起来更符合用户习惯。例如,我们可以用CSS实现按钮的悬浮效果、背景色变化以及整体布局的栅格化,确保计算器在不同屏幕尺寸下都能良好展示。 JavaScript文件是计算器的核心,它处理所有的逻辑计算。JavaScript代码通常会在按钮点击事件触发时运行,读取当前输入的数值,执行相应的操作,并更新结果显示在HTML页面上。例如,当用户点击数字按钮时,JavaScript会将数值添加到输入框;点击运算符按钮则保存当前的运算表达式;按下等号按钮时,JavaScript会解析表达式并执行计算,然后将结果显示出来。在这个过程中,JavaScript可能需要使用到一些内置函数,如`parseFloat()`用于转换字符串为浮点数,`eval()`用于执行计算表达式,以及数组来存储中间结果。 为了处理复杂的计算,比如括号、优先级和连续运算,JavaScript代码需要实现一个解析器或者借用现成的库来解析表达式。同时,为了防止除以零错误,代码还需要添加异常处理机制。 创建一个JavaScript计算器涉及到HTML布局、CSS美化和JavaScript逻辑处理三个环节。这是一项很好的练习,可以提升对前端开发的理解,尤其是JavaScript的基本语法和DOM操作。对于初学者,这是一个很好的起点,因为实现一个简单的计算器可以帮助他们理解JavaScript如何与HTML和CSS协同工作,同时也提供了深入学习的机会,如错误处理、正则表达式和更高级的算法实现。
- 1
- lodening2023-01-03感谢资源主的分享,很值得参考学习,资源价值较高,支持!
- 粉丝: 64
- 资源: 3951
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助